Salvage Work At Damaged Administration Building, November 1971 Photographer: Cecil Lockard
Year:
1971
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, November 25, 1971
Caption:
Salvage crews remove equipment and records from the Ann Arbor School Administration Building, 1220 Wells, which was heavily damaged by a fire early Sunday. According to Supt. R. Bruce McPherson a substantial quantity of financial records and other important data has already been retrieved from the building, and other material will be removed after the remains of the roof have been taken off to assure safety of the work crews.

Demolition Of 1220 Wells Street Building, August 1972 Photographer: Cecil Lockard
Year:
1972
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, August 26, 1972
Caption:
A spellbound audience watches through the mist this morning as a power shovel completes the destruction of the Ann Arbor School District's administration building at 1220 Wells St. The police and fire departments said the $200,000 blaze which gutted the 55-year-old building last Nov. 21 was started by arsonists who were never found. The building served as Eberbach Elementary School until 1951 and was reopened in 1956 as the administration building. The site has been purchased by the City of Ann Arbor and may be used for the Burns Park Cultural Center or a park. (News photo by Cecil Lockard)
